Roasted Brussels Sprouts

Featured in: Oven & Pan Cooking

Transform humble Brussels sprouts into an irresistible side dish with high-heat roasting. The cut sides develop deep caramelization while edges turn satisfyingly crispy, contrasting beautifully with tender interiors. A simple coating of olive oil, salt, and pepper enhances their natural nutty sweetness, while optional garlic powder and smoked paprika add depth. This versatile technique works as a weeknight vegetable side or holiday centerpiece.

  • 500 g Brussels sprouts: Fresh ones with tight, bright green heads work best. Ive learned that smaller sprouts tend to caramelize more evenly.
  • 2 tbsp olive oil: This helps the seasonings stick and promotes that beautiful golden browning. Dont skimp here.
  • 1/2 tsp sea salt: Essential for drawing out moisture and concentrating flavor.
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per: Freshly ground makes a noticeable difference in depth.
  • Optional seasonings: Garlic powder and smoked paprika add layers without overwhelming the vegetables natural taste.
Get your oven ready:
Preheat to 220°C and line your baking sheet with parchment paper. This saves cleanup time later.
Coat the sprouts:
In a large bowl, toss everything together until each piece is glistening. Use your hands to really massage the oil and spices into the crevices.
Arrange for success:
Spread them cut side down in a single layer. This positioning is crucial for getting those caramelized flat edges.
Roast to perfection:
Let them cook for 20 to 25 minutes, stirring once halfway through. You want deep golden brown edges, not just pale green.
Serve immediately:
Transfer to a serving dish while they are still hot and sizzling. They are best enjoyed straight from the oven.

High heat is your friend here. The maillard reaction that creates those crispy, browned edges is where all the flavor lives. I used to be afraid of burning vegetables, but now I push them until they are almost too dark. That slight char is what makes people think these came from a professional kitchen.

Sometimes I finish these with a squeeze of fresh lemon juice right before serving. The acid brightens everything and cuts through the richness. A drizzle of balsamic glaze creates this sweet and tangy glaze that clings to every leaf.

Recipe FAQs

Why do my Brussels sprouts turn mushy instead of crispy?

Mushiness typically results from overcrowding the pan or insufficient oven heat. Arrange sprouts in a single layer with space between pieces for proper air circulation. A hot oven (220°C/425°F) creates the necessary caramelization. Avoid flipping too frequently—let them develop golden crust before stirring halfway through cooking.

Should I cut Brussels sprouts in half before roasting?

Halving creates flat surfaces that contact the baking sheet directly, promoting even browning and caramelization. Leave small sprouts whole if they're under 2.5 cm (1 inch) in diameter, but halve larger ones to ensure consistent cooking throughout.

What seasonings work best with roasted Brussels sprouts?

Beyond salt and pepper, garlic powder adds savory depth, while smoked paprika brings subtle warmth and color. Fresh herbs like thyme or rosemary work beautifully when added during the last 5 minutes of roasting. A finishing drizzle of balsamic glaze or squeeze of lemon brightens flavors.

How do I know when Brussels sprouts are done roasting?

Perfectly roasted sprouts display deep golden-brown caramelization on the cut surfaces and edges. The exteriors should offer slight crispness when touched, while interiors yield easily to a knife. Total roasting time typically ranges from 20-25 minutes at high heat, depending on sprout size.

Can roasted Brussels sprouts be made ahead?

For optimal texture, serve immediately after roasting while edges remain crispy. To prepare ahead, trim and halve sprouts up to 24 hours in advance, storing refrigerated in an airtight container. Toss with oil and seasonings just before roasting. Reheated sprouts won't retain the same crunch but remain flavorful.

Roasted Brussels Sprouts

Golden, caramelized Brussels sprouts with crispy edges and tender centers. Simple seasoning lets their natural sweetness shine through.

Prep Time
10 min
Cooking Duration
25 min
Overall Time
35 min
Recipe by Leonard Phelps


Skill Level Easy

Cuisine American

Makes 4 Portions

Dietary Details Plant-Based, No Dairy, No Gluten, Reduced-Carb

What You Need

Vegetables

01 1 lb Brussels sprouts, trimmed and halved

Oils & Fats

01 2 tbsp olive oil

Seasonings

01 1/2 tsp sea salt
02 1/4 tsp freshly ground black pepper
03 1/4 tsp garlic powder
04 1/4 tsp smoked paprika

Directions

Step 01

Preheat Oven: Preheat the oven to 425°F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cleanup.

Step 02

Season Brussels Sprouts: Place the halved Brussels sprouts in a large bowl. Drizzle with olive oil and sprinkle with sea sal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and smoked paprika. Toss thoroughly until every piece is evenly coated.

Step 03

Arrange for Roasting: Spread the seasoned Brussels sprouts cut side down on the prepared baking sheet. Arrange them in a single layer with space between each piece to ensure proper caramelization.

Step 04

Roast to Perfection: Roast for 20-25 minutes, stirring once halfway through cooking. The sprouts are done when they're deep golden brown with caramelized edges and tender when pierced with a fork.

Step 05

Serve Immediately: Transfer the roasted Brussels sprouts to a serving dish. Serve hot while they're at their crispiest. Consider adding optional toppings like lemon juice, balsamic glaze, or Parmesan before serving.
